[發(fā)明專利]一種基于改進(jìn)NMS算法的目標(biāo)檢測(cè)方法在審
| 申請(qǐng)?zhí)枺?/td> | 202110888783.1 | 申請(qǐng)日: | 2021-08-03 |
| 公開(kāi)(公告)號(hào): | CN113591734A | 公開(kāi)(公告)日: | 2021-11-02 |
| 發(fā)明(設(shè)計(jì))人: | 孟慶巖;張琳琳;趙茂帆;安健健 | 申請(qǐng)(專利權(quán))人: | 中國(guó)科學(xué)院空天信息創(chuàng)新研究院;三亞中科遙感研究所 |
| 主分類號(hào): | G06K9/00 | 分類號(hào): | G06K9/00;G06K9/62;G06N3/04;G06N3/08 |
| 代理公司: | 北京億騰知識(shí)產(chǎn)權(quán)代理事務(wù)所(普通合伙) 11309 | 代理人: | 陳霽 |
| 地址: | 100101 *** | 國(guó)省代碼: | 北京;11 |
| 權(quán)利要求書(shū): | 查看更多 | 說(shuō)明書(shū): |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 基于 改進(jìn) nms 算法 目標(biāo) 檢測(cè) 方法 | ||
針對(duì)NMS算法的數(shù)據(jù)處理過(guò)程中,計(jì)算過(guò)程粗暴,有較大的計(jì)算缺陷,本發(fā)明在傳統(tǒng)NMS算法第四部數(shù)據(jù)計(jì)算中,進(jìn)行置信度歸零法改進(jìn)及貪婪法篩選候選框改進(jìn),公開(kāi)了一種基于改進(jìn)NMS算法的目標(biāo)檢測(cè)方法,減小計(jì)算工作量,提高檢測(cè)的效率;該方法包括如下步驟:步驟1)基于NMS算法,設(shè)置所有候選框篩選時(shí)固定的閾值Sc;步驟2)對(duì)候選框集合B進(jìn)行降序排列;步驟3)將候選框集合B中最高的置信度值添加保留至集合D中,并從集合B中移除A;步驟4)計(jì)算A、B兩個(gè)候選框集合中剩余候選框的I OU值,采用面積比較法和重疊部分長(zhǎng)度比較法來(lái)改進(jìn)貪婪方式篩選過(guò)程;步驟5)對(duì)候選框集合全部進(jìn)行上述數(shù)據(jù)處理過(guò)程;步驟6)基于此方法進(jìn)行目標(biāo)檢測(cè)。
技術(shù)領(lǐng)域
本發(fā)明涉及一種基于改進(jìn)NMS算法的目標(biāo)檢測(cè)方法,基于NMS算法的改 進(jìn)提高了檢測(cè)精度,而且加快了檢測(cè)速度。
背景技術(shù)
近年來(lái),隨著圖像數(shù)據(jù)的指數(shù)型增長(zhǎng)與計(jì)算機(jī)技術(shù)的高速發(fā)展,深度學(xué)習(xí)的 實(shí)踐能力被得到廣泛開(kāi)發(fā)。基于深度學(xué)習(xí)的目標(biāo)檢測(cè)算法通過(guò)將大量數(shù)據(jù)輸入 多層神經(jīng)網(wǎng)絡(luò)結(jié)構(gòu)中,將圖像數(shù)據(jù)轉(zhuǎn)換成計(jì)算機(jī)能夠識(shí)別的特征向量,經(jīng)過(guò)計(jì)算 機(jī)對(duì)數(shù)據(jù)特征的提取,自動(dòng)學(xué)習(xí)數(shù)據(jù)中蘊(yùn)含的特征信息,最終得到更為抽象的數(shù) 據(jù)特征,避免了事先進(jìn)行人為特征標(biāo)定的弊端,因而該網(wǎng)絡(luò)學(xué)習(xí)能力和檢測(cè)準(zhǔn)確 率都極大提高,同時(shí)具有較強(qiáng)的泛化能力和魯棒性。傳統(tǒng)目標(biāo)檢測(cè)算法由于檢測(cè) 精度達(dá)不到實(shí)際需求,且特征表達(dá)能力不強(qiáng),已不能滿足生產(chǎn)實(shí)踐和經(jīng)濟(jì)發(fā)展的 需要,深度學(xué)習(xí)目標(biāo)檢測(cè)算法與此相比展現(xiàn)了強(qiáng)大的功能,在計(jì)算機(jī)硬件水平的 支持下,快速進(jìn)行大量數(shù)據(jù)計(jì)算與處理,已成為目標(biāo)檢測(cè)的主流技術(shù)。通過(guò)對(duì)八 種典型目標(biāo)檢測(cè)算法進(jìn)行性能對(duì)比,比較各算法的優(yōu)缺點(diǎn),并得出結(jié)論,同時(shí)在 該數(shù)據(jù)集上選取性能較優(yōu)的YOLOv4算法進(jìn)行非極大值抑制算法的改進(jìn),并對(duì) 比改進(jìn)前后檢測(cè)精度和檢測(cè)時(shí)間的差異,展示改進(jìn)算法的優(yōu)勢(shì),最后將改進(jìn)后的 YOLOv4算法開(kāi)發(fā)成軟件,以便更好的應(yīng)用于生產(chǎn)實(shí)踐。
發(fā)明內(nèi)容
針對(duì)NMS算法過(guò)程中具有較大的計(jì)算缺陷問(wèn)題,提出了一種基于改進(jìn)NMS 算法的目標(biāo)檢測(cè)方法,該方法包括如下步驟(其中深度網(wǎng)絡(luò)計(jì)算輸出的所有候選 的預(yù)檢框集合可用B表示,采用NMS算法進(jìn)行篩選等數(shù)據(jù)處理,得到的檢測(cè)框 集合可用D表示,候選框集合對(duì)應(yīng)的置信度值集合可用S表示,A表示所有候選 框集合中置信度值最高的檢測(cè)框,Sc表示候選框篩選時(shí)設(shè)置的閾值,Nt表示為 IOU計(jì)算時(shí)設(shè)置的重疊閾值):
步驟1)設(shè)置所有候選框篩選時(shí)固定的閾值Sc,將候選框集合B中置信度 值小于篩選閾值的預(yù)檢框的置信度值設(shè)置為0;
步驟2)以候選框置信度值為依據(jù),對(duì)候選框集合B進(jìn)行降序排列;
步驟3)將候選框集合B中最高的置信度值添加保留至集合D中,并從集合 B中移除A;
步驟4)計(jì)算A、B兩個(gè)候選框集合中剩余候選框的IOU值,設(shè)置IOU篩選 重疊閾值Nt,將候選框集合計(jì)算結(jié)果中大于重疊閾值的候選框的置信度值設(shè)為 0;
步驟5)根據(jù)設(shè)置固定的篩選閾值,對(duì)候選框集合全部進(jìn)行上述2)、3)、4) 數(shù)據(jù)處理過(guò)程,完成所有候選框的篩選工作;
步驟6)基于此方法進(jìn)行目標(biāo)檢測(cè)。
進(jìn)一步,所述步驟4)的具體方法為:
使用分段函數(shù)來(lái)完成對(duì)置信度的調(diào)整,置信度調(diào)整的關(guān)鍵在于各個(gè)線性函 數(shù)斜率的確定方式和斜率的大小以及取值區(qū)間范圍的劃分。綜合考慮,將Nt的 值選為0.3。在確定了Nt的值后,又將函數(shù)區(qū)間分為了五個(gè)區(qū)段,衰減速率會(huì) 隨著IOU和重疊閾值之間距離的增大而隨之增大,線性函數(shù)各個(gè)分段區(qū)域的斜 率的絕對(duì)值大小也應(yīng)隨之增大。通過(guò)計(jì)算可得各個(gè)分段線性函數(shù)的衰減系數(shù)值。
進(jìn)一步,所述步驟4)的具體方法為:
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于中國(guó)科學(xué)院空天信息創(chuàng)新研究院;三亞中科遙感研究所,未經(jīng)中國(guó)科學(xué)院空天信息創(chuàng)新研究院;三亞中科遙感研究所許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110888783.1/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專利網(wǎng)。
- 同類專利
- 專利分類
G06K 數(shù)據(jù)識(shí)別;數(shù)據(jù)表示;記錄載體;記錄載體的處理
G06K9-00 用于閱讀或識(shí)別印刷或書(shū)寫字符或者用于識(shí)別圖形,例如,指紋的方法或裝置
G06K9-03 .錯(cuò)誤的檢測(cè)或校正,例如,用重復(fù)掃描圖形的方法
G06K9-18 .應(yīng)用具有附加代碼標(biāo)記或含有代碼標(biāo)記的打印字符的,例如,由不同形狀的各個(gè)筆畫(huà)組成的,而且每個(gè)筆畫(huà)表示不同的代碼值的字符
G06K9-20 .圖像捕獲
G06K9-36 .圖像預(yù)處理,即無(wú)須判定關(guān)于圖像的同一性而進(jìn)行的圖像信息處理
G06K9-60 .圖像捕獲和多種預(yù)處理作用的組合
- 一種虛擬私有網(wǎng)絡(luò)的網(wǎng)絡(luò)管理系統(tǒng)及其實(shí)現(xiàn)方法
- 自動(dòng)接口測(cè)試框架
- 一種集中網(wǎng)管的實(shí)現(xiàn)方法
- 網(wǎng)絡(luò)管理系統(tǒng)共享部分暫停規(guī)則的方法及裝置
- 一種集中網(wǎng)管的實(shí)現(xiàn)方法
- 雙向鏈路狀態(tài)檢測(cè)方法、EMS及系統(tǒng)
- N-甲基5-羥色胺和相關(guān)物質(zhì)用于治療/減少絕經(jīng)期相關(guān)熱潮紅的發(fā)生
- 一種網(wǎng)絡(luò)管理系統(tǒng)部署方法、裝置和網(wǎng)絡(luò)管理系統(tǒng)
- 告警上報(bào)方法
- 基站開(kāi)站方法、裝置、計(jì)算機(jī)存儲(chǔ)介質(zhì)及設(shè)備





